Summary: Loses Focus. Serves as intro to Luftwaffe's air war
Comment: I approached this book looking for a detailed acount of the Bf 109 as it performed against its adversaries and was developed to meet the demands of the war. I was hoping for something complementary to Prien and Rodeike's "Messerschmitt Bf 109 G, F, K" book, but giving us a more encompassing view of the 109-- after all, we have the space of an entire book to work with.
The book starts out well enough detailing the 109's development, but slowly loses focus on the plane itself and begins giving us just a generalized history of the air war from the German point of view. There were no specific details on the plane.
The book may be a decent introduction for someone starting out learning about the Luftwaffe, but by no means is for someone who already has a good working knowledge, and is looking for a detailed treatment of the 109 as an airplane. I see little reason for the book to have the title it does. I give it only 2 stars because i was expecting a book wholly on the 109, not a general history of the Luftwaffe's air war.
